Transaction 49cc6fba37ad796342111a2624fc49244bb012f76dbdbc84b1ce38be59fdc330

1 Input
1 Outputs
  • 49cc6fba37ad796342111a2624fc49244bb012f76dbdbc84b1ce38be59fdc330:0
  • value  6377882
    address  1HfspDjh37yU1u8suzsTLhebbX1bbMxjZu